    yellow ? mark

    i just did a restore on my dell computer, and i am using windows xp, but i cannot connect to the internet. I have a yellow ? mark next to my ethenet controller sign. what can i do?

    We need to know what model your network card is. Speccy from www.ccleaner.com might find it for you. If your computer is a brand name give us the model number and brand and we may be able to lead you in the right direction.
